Bloody attack in Kaiama as farmers, herders clash

By Ahmed Ajikobi

There was pandemonium in Salude Village, Kaiama, Local Government Area as Fulani herders and farmers engaged in bloody attack which resulted in one of the duo group inflicted with serious injury.

It was gathered that, growing incidences of Fulani herders and farmers clashes in that area continued unabated which emanated to another face-off between two warring families which resulted in the matchete attack on a member of one of the families.

The outcome of the bloody attack left Abubakar Sulade, 16, with a deep cut in his right hand while the assailants are still at large.

The NSCDC spokesman, Kwara State Command Babawale Afolabi who confirmed the incident stated that the matter was reported at NSCDC’s Divisional Office in Kaiama and manhunt has been launched for the assailant and his accomplice.

“There has been a long term face off between two families over a grazing land which took a bloody turn recently when one family attacked others with matchete which resulted in the grievous bodily harm to one Abubakar Sulade, 16, who got a deep cut on his hand. He was reportedly attacked by one Bugi Juli who is still at large.” Afolabi narrated.

He explained further that NSCDC has increased its surveillance and patrol in the neighborhood adding that the victim has been successfully treated in the hospital while further investigations are ongoing and there is a move to invite the warring families for peace meeting.
